Modele Pydantic mogą być zagnieżdżane — pole modelu może być samo innym modelem, listą modeli lub typami złożonymi — pozwalając FastAPI na automatyczne walidowanie głęboko ustrukturyzowanego JSON (obiekty w obiektach, tablice obiektów).
Modele zagnieżdżone
pydantic BaseModel
():
street:
city:
:
():
name:
address: Address
tags: [] = []
addresses: [Address] = []
():
user
